网站优化是每个网站管理员和开发者都非常关心的话题,在众多的前端技术中,jQuery因其轻量级和易用性而广受欢迎,就让我们一起探讨如何利用jQuery为网站注入新的活力,提升用户体验和搜索引擎优化(SEO)效果。
我们需要了解jQuery是什么,jQuery是一个快速、小巧且功能丰富的JavaScript库,它让HTML文档遍历和操作、事件处理、动画和Ajax等操作变得更加简单,无需编写大量的JavaScript代码。
网站加载速度优化
网站的加载速度对用户体验至关重要,使用jQuery,我们可以异步加载资源,减少页面加载时间,通过jQuery的$.ajax()
方法,我们可以在不刷新整个页面的情况下加载数据,这样用户就能更快地看到内容。
$.ajax({ url: 'data.json', type: 'GET', success: function(data) { // 处理加载的数据 }, error: function() { // 处理错误 } });
加载是提高网站互动性和用户体验的有效方法,jQuery的.load()
方法允许我们从服务器加载数据,并将其放入指定的元素中。
$('#result').load('ajax/test.html');
增强表单交互
表单是网站与用户互动的重要部分,使用jQuery,我们可以轻松地添加表单验证和实时反馈,通过.on()
方法监听表单提交事件,并在提交前进行验证。
$('#myForm').on('submit', function(e) { e.preventDefault(); // 进行表单验证 if (isValid()) { // 提交表单 } });
动画效果
动画效果可以让网站看起来更加生动和吸引人,jQuery的.animate()
方法可以让我们轻松地为元素添加动画效果。
$('#box').animate({ opacity: 0.5, height: "300px" }, 500);
SEO优化
搜索引擎优化(SEO)是提高网站可见性的关键,使用jQuery,我们可以动态生成内容,而不需要在HTML中静态地放置所有内容,这样,搜索引擎可以更好地索引网站内容。
$(document).ready(function() { // 动态生成SEO友好的内容 });
响应式设计
随着移动设备的普及,响应式设计变得越来越重要,jQuery可以帮助我们检测屏幕尺寸,并根据屏幕尺寸加载不同的CSS样式。
$(document).ready(function() { if ($(window).width() < 768) { // 加载手机版样式 } else { // 加载桌面版样式 } });
用户体验增强
用户体验是网站成功的关键,jQuery可以帮助我们实现各种交互效果,如下拉菜单、模态窗口等,提升用户体验。
$('#myButton').click(function() { $('#myModal').modal('show'); });
通过上述方法,我们可以看到jQuery在网站开发中的多方面应用,它不仅可以提高网站的功能性和互动性,还可以帮助我们实现更好的SEO效果和用户体验,jQuery的使用,无疑会为网站开发带来巨大的便利和优势。
还没有评论,来说两句吧...